Antiferromagnetism and hidden order in isoelectronic doping of URu2Si2
Abstract
We present muon spin rotation (μSR) and susceptibility measurements on single crystals of isoelectronically doped URu2−xTxSi2 (T = Fe, Os) for doping levels up to 50%. Zero field (ZF) μSR measurements show long-lived oscillations demonstrating that an antiferromagnetic state exists down to low doping levels for both Os and Fe dopants.
